Regulation A+ Offerings

Regulation A+ offerings, often simply referred to as Reg A+, offer a unique pathway for companies aiming capital through the public markets. This framework allows smaller businesses to raise up to a total of $50 million in a single offering, making it a viable alternative in contrast to traditional IPOs.

The SEC implemented Reg A+ in 2015 as a means to strengthen capital formation for smaller companies relaxing the regulatory hurdles. With this structure, companies {can tap into a wider pool of investors exterior to their immediate networks.

Regulation A+ Offerings

Securities and Exchange Commission regulation commonly refer to as Regulation A+, is a instrument in U.S. securities law that allows companies to raise capital indirectly from the investing public. This exception permits businesses to offer their securities without the typical stringent registration procedures of a traditional initial public offering (IPO). Regulation A+ offerings are designed to be more accessible to smaller businesses, permitting them to secure funding through a wider base of investors.
Regulation A+ has two tiers: Tier 1 allows companies to raise up to $20 million in a six month period, while Tier 2 permits raises of up to $50 million over the same timeframe. Companies aiming to harness Regulation A+ must satisfy specific reporting requirements, including filing a detailed offering statement with the SEC.
